On the Jacobi Group and the Mapping Class Group of $S^3\times S^3$

Abstract

The paper containes a proof that the mapping class group of the manifold S3×S3S^3\times S^3 is isomorphic to a central extension of the (full) Jacobi group ΓJ\Gamma^J by the group of 7-dimensional homotopy spheres. Using a presentation of the group ΓJ\Gamma^J and the μ\mu-invariant of the homotopy spheres, we give a presentation of the mapping class group of S3×S3S^3\times S^3 with generators and defining relations. We also compute cohomology of the group ΓJ\Gamma^J and determine a 2-cocycle that corresponds to the mapping class group of S3×S3S^3\times S^3.
